bondethernets:
  BondEthernet0:
    interfaces: [ GigabitEthernet3/0/0, GigabitEthernet3/0/1 ]

interfaces:
  GigabitEthernet3/0/0:
    mtu: 9000
    description: "LAG #1"
  GigabitEthernet3/0/1:
    mtu: 9000
    description: "LAG #2"

  HundredGigabitEthernet12/0/0:
    lcp: "ice0"

  HundredGigabitEthernet12/0/1:
    lcp: "ice1"
    mtu: 9000
    addresses: [ 192.0.2.17/30, 2001:db8:3::1/64 ]
    sub-interfaces:
      1234:
        mtu: 1500
        lcp: "ice1.1234"
        encapsulation:
          dot1q: 1234
          exact-match: True
      1235:
        mtu: 1400
        lcp: "ice1.1234.1000"
        encapsulation:
          dot1q: 1234
          inner-dot1q: 1000
          exact-match: True


  BondEthernet0:
    mtu: 9000
    lcp: "be0"
    sub-interfaces:
      100:
        mtu: 2500
        l2xc: BondEthernet0.200
        encapsulation:
           dot1q: 100
           exact-match: False
      200:
        mtu: 2500
        l2xc: BondEthernet0.100
        encapsulation:
           dot1q: 200
           exact-match: False
      500:
        mtu: 2000
        encapsulation:
           dot1ad: 500
           exact-match: False
      501:
        mtu: 2000
        encapsulation:
           dot1ad: 501
           exact-match: False
  vxlan_tunnel1:
    mtu: 1500

loopbacks:
  loop1:
    lcp: "bvi1"
    addresses: [ 192.0.2.1/30 ]
  loop2:
    lcp: "bvi2"
    addresses: [ 192.0.2.5/30 ]

bridgedomains:
  bd1:
    mtu: 2000
    bvi: loop2
    interfaces: [ BondEthernet0.500, BondEthernet0.501 ]
    settings:
      mac-age-minutes: 10
      learn: False
  bd11:
    mtu: 1500

vxlan_tunnels:
  vxlan_tunnel1:
    local: 192.0.2.1
    remote: 192.0.2.2
    vni: 101